Abstract

The invention discloses a method and a system for realizing a distributed multi-port DHCP relay. The method comprises the steps that a DHCP relay receives a DHCP request message sent by a DHCP client to a network, writes access unit information and a port or VLAN sub port information into an extended attribute Option, wherein the access unit information and the port or the VLAN sub port information receive the DHCP request message, and sends the DHCP request message added with the extended attribute Option to a DHCP server; the DHCP relay acquires a response message sent by the DHCP server, wherein the response message comprises an IP address assigned by the DHCP server to the DHCP client and retains the extended attribute Option; and the extended attribute Option is analyzed, so as to select a corresponding access unit and port or a VLAN sub port to forward the DHCP response message to the DHCP client. According to the invention, the DHCP relay can select the correct access unit and port or the VLAN sub port to forward the DHCP message, and the reliability is improved to some extent.

Background technology
DHCP agreement provides a kind of method of dynamic IP address allocation and configuration parameter.DHCP agreement has a server (Server), and the user of all applied addresses is client (Client), and server S erver is responsible for distributing address to whole client Client.
In the middle of practical application, at client Client and server Server, indirectly connected in the situation that, system need to provide dhcp relay feature, by DHCP relay, sends to server to process the solicited message unification of client.
In the situation that using DHCP relay, if the client Client number accessing in system is numerous, DHCP relay may need to provide a plurality of access units, and each access unit may provide a plurality of ports.Under some occasion, between a plurality of client Client due to the reason of safety, may need mutual isolation, for example, by VPN(Virtual Private Network, VPN (virtual private network)) isolate, be that different client Client need to select the different port of the different access units of DHCP relay to carry out the forward process of message, therefore, in practical application, if can not guarantee DHCP relay receives and dispatches from the port of correct access unit when processing dhcp message, may cause dhcp message to be lost, client Client can not correctly obtain IP address and the configuration parameter of distribution.

The DHCP agreement of standard provides many extended attribute supports (referring to RFC2132 etc.), and these extended attributes Option can allow the use function of the expansion DHCP of each producer agreement.If the expanded function of Option definition, is generally acknowledged by industry and accepts, with RFC form, confirm, as recommending or official standard, for example Option 82 is exactly one of standard of confirming with RFC3046.
Consider that DHCP agreement has numerous extended fields, the consideration based on the compatible DHCP agreement of trying one's best, in the embodiment of the present invention 1, comparatively preferably, described extended attribute Option is Option 82 extended attributes.Option 82 is set to dhcp relay agent Custom Attributes field in RFC, and therefore its content and realize Ke Youge producer and confirm voluntarily to use selects Option 82 compatible best in DHCP relay.
As shown in Figure 2, the DHCP flow process that step 1,3,6,8 is standard, the Extended Protocol flow process that step 2,4,5,7,9,10 is DHCP, below illustrates it.
Step 1, is the discovery step in the DHCP of standard, and dhcp client sends DHCPDISCOVER message to network and finds Dynamic Host Configuration Protocol server.
Step 2, DHCP relay receives after the DHCPDISCOVER of dhcp client, access unit information and port information that record receives, and in DHCPDISCOVER, select Option 82 options, access unit information and port information are filled in into.DHCP relay is transmitted to Dynamic Host Configuration Protocol server by dhcp discover.
Step 3, is the step that provides in the DHCP of standard, and Dynamic Host Configuration Protocol server provides IP address lease by message DHCPOFFER to client, retains Option 82 options simultaneously in DHCPOFFER message.
Step 4, DHCP relay receives after the DHCPOFFER of Dynamic Host Configuration Protocol server, resolves Option 82 options, extracts access unit information and the port information of the inside, and deletes Option 82 option contents wherein.
Step 5, DHCP relay sends to dhcp client from the designated port of the access unit of appointment by DHCPOFFER by access unit information and the port information extracting.
Step 6, is the request step in the DHCP of standard, and dhcp client sends DHCPREQUEST message to network, to its selected Dynamic Host Configuration Protocol server request distributing IP address.
Step 7, DHCP relay receives after DHCPREQUEST, access unit information and port information that record receives, and in DHCPREQUEST, increase Option 82 options, access unit information and port information are filled in into.DHCP relay is transmitted to Dynamic Host Configuration Protocol server by DHCPREQUEST message.
Step 8, is the confirmation step in the DHCP of standard, if the success of distributing IP address, Dynamic Host Configuration Protocol server sends the DHCPACK message of the IP address that comprises distribution to dhcp client; If the failure of distributing IP address, sends DHCPNACK message, in DHCPACK/NAC message, retain Option 82 options simultaneously.
Step 9, DHCP relay receives after DHCPACK/NACK, resolves Option 82 options, extracts access unit information and the port information of the inside, and deletes Option 82 option contents wherein.
Step 10, DHCP relay sends to dhcp client from the designated port of the access unit of appointment by DHCPACK/NACK by access unit information and the port information extracting.
